I think lightning is just an assembly/CPU abstraction
like the md_* abstraction pnet already has.

It is not a JIT abstraction like libjit. ie take
trees/3 address codes and allow to run it . 

Lightning could be a backend for libjit, not a
replacement. libjit should handle all
optimisation/liveness analysis and other black magic
to be done for fast execution.

Thats just my understanding.
